WebC=C. 0.134 nm. Note: "nm" means "nanometre", which is 10 -9 metre. That would mean that the hexagon would be irregular if it had the Kekulé structure, with alternating shorter and longer sides. In real benzene all the bonds are exactly the same - intermediate in length between C-C and C=C at 0.139 nm. Real benzene is a perfectly regular hexagon. WebAtoms with multiple bonds between them have shorter bond lengths than singly bonded ones; this is a major criterion for experimentally determining the multiplicity of a bond. For example, the bond length of C - C C −C is 154 pm; the bond length of C = C C = C is 133 pm; and finally, the bond length of C \equiv C C ≡ C is 120 pm. Show Sources

WebThe existence of a very long C-C bond length of up to 290 pm is claimed in a dimer of two tetracyanoethylenedianions although this concerns a 2-electron-4-center bond .This type of bonding has also been observed in dimers of neutral phenalene dimers.
